What they do

A Payroll Specialist manages the financial and accounting work involved in processing payroll for a company or organization. Manages employee benefits programs and payroll deductions, or assists with evaluating compensation levels for different job categories and titles.

PAYROLL & BENEFITS PROCESSOR
- Anchorage Vacancy No VN906 Employment Type Full Time Non-Exempt Location Anchorage-Central Office Salary Range $24.11-$29.78 DOE Salary Period Hourly Benefits Full time-eligible to participate in the benefit programs on the first day of the month after your 60th day of employment. Job Details
JOB SUMMARY
Provides clerical and administrative support across multiple functions, with a primary focus on payroll processing, and benefits administration. This role ensures accurate data entry, supports compliance, and helps maintain smooth payroll operations across a geographically dispersed workforce. This is a developmental position designed to build core HR and payroll competencies, with growth opportunities within the department.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S, D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
Payroll Support Assist with processing payroll, including data entry for hours, earnings, and deductions Review payroll information for accuracy and flag discrepancies for resolution Maintain payroll records and ensure proper documentation Support payroll reporting and help prepare information for audits and tax filings Benefits Administration Support Assist with benefits enrollment, changes, and terminations as needed Maintain benefits records and update employee information in HR systems as needed Respond to basic employee questions regarding benefits and eligibility as needed Support open enrollment and related communications as needed Compliance & Data Integrity Ensure confidentiality of employee information Follow established policies and procedures Support compliance with employment laws and organizational standards through accurate recordkeeping
